百度蜘蛛池原理图讲解图,百度蜘蛛池原理图讲解图片_小恐龙蜘蛛池
关闭引导
百度蜘蛛池原理图讲解图,百度蜘蛛池原理图讲解图片
2024-12-24 03:36
小恐龙蜘蛛池

百度蜘蛛池原理图讲解图及图片展示了如何构建和管理一个高效的百度蜘蛛池。该图包括多个关键组件,如爬虫、爬虫控制器、数据存储和数据分析工具。图中详细描述了每个组件的功能和它们之间的交互方式,以及如何通过优化爬虫策略、合理调度资源、有效管理数据来提高爬取效率和准确性。图片还展示了如何根据业务需求调整爬虫参数,以实现更精准的爬取目标。这些讲解图和图片对于理解百度蜘蛛池的工作原理和构建高效的网络爬虫系统非常有帮助。

在搜索引擎优化(SEO)领域,百度蜘蛛池(Spider Pool)是一个重要的概念,它涉及搜索引擎爬虫(Spider)的集中管理和资源分配,通过优化蜘蛛池,网站可以更有效地吸引百度的爬虫,提高抓取效率和页面收录速度,本文将详细讲解百度蜘蛛池的原理图,并深入探讨其背后的技术细节和实际应用。

什么是百度蜘蛛池

百度蜘蛛池是百度搜索引擎用来管理和调度其网络爬虫的一系列服务器和算法,这些爬虫负责定期访问和抓取互联网上的新内容,以便更新百度的搜索结果,通过集中管理这些爬虫,百度可以更有效地分配资源,提高抓取效率,确保搜索引擎的实时性和准确性。

蜘蛛池原理图讲解

为了更直观地理解蜘蛛池的工作原理,我们来看一张简化的原理图:

1、爬虫分配模块:这个模块负责根据网站的权重、更新频率等因素,将爬虫任务分配给不同的服务器或节点,这样可以确保每个网站都能得到适当的抓取频率,同时避免过度抓取对网站造成负担。

2、爬虫队列:所有待抓取的URL都会被放入一个队列中,爬虫分配模块会根据优先级和负载情况,从队列中取出URL分配给具体的爬虫。

3、爬虫执行模块:这是实际执行抓取操作的模块,每个爬虫都会根据分配的任务,访问指定的网页,并提取所需的信息(如标题、链接、内容等)。

4、数据回传模块:抓取到的数据会被传回数据中心,经过处理后存入数据库,供搜索引擎算法使用。

5、反馈与优化模块:通过对抓取数据的分析和反馈,不断优化爬虫策略,提高抓取效率和准确性,如果发现某个网站的更新速度很快,可以增加对该网站的抓取频率。

技术细节与应用

1、分布式架构:百度蜘蛛池采用分布式架构,可以灵活扩展和伸缩,随着网站数量和页面数量的增加,可以轻松添加更多的服务器和节点,确保系统的稳定性和高效性。

2、智能调度算法:通过智能调度算法,可以实现对爬虫的精细化管理,可以根据网站的权重和更新频率,动态调整爬虫的抓取速度和频率;还可以根据网络状况和服务器负载情况,进行负载均衡和故障转移。

3、缓存机制:为了提高抓取效率,百度蜘蛛池还采用了缓存机制,对于已经抓取过的页面或数据,会进行缓存处理,避免重复抓取和浪费资源,缓存还可以加速数据回传和存储过程。

4、安全机制:为了防止恶意攻击和非法访问,百度蜘蛛池还配备了严格的安全机制,可以限制爬虫的访问频率和IP地址;还可以对抓取的数据进行加密处理,确保数据的安全性和隐私性。

实际应用与案例

1、新闻网站:对于新闻网站来说,内容更新非常频繁且重要,通过优化百度蜘蛛池的配置和策略,可以确保新闻内容被及时抓取和收录;同时还可以通过设置优先级和权重参数,提高重要新闻页面的抓取频率和排名。

2、电商网站:电商网站通常拥有大量的商品信息和页面,通过合理配置百度蜘蛛池的参数和策略,可以确保商品信息被及时抓取和展示;同时还可以通过分析用户行为和搜索趋势,优化商品页面的结构和内容。

3、企业官网:企业官网通常包含大量的产品介绍、公司新闻和联系方式等信息,通过优化百度蜘蛛池的配置和策略,可以提高官网的收录速度和排名;同时还可以通过设置自定义的抓取规则和过滤条件,确保只抓取有用的信息并忽略无关内容。

结论与展望

百度蜘蛛池作为SEO领域的重要工具之一,在提高网站抓取效率和排名方面发挥着重要作用,通过深入了解其工作原理和技术细节,我们可以更好地配置和优化蜘蛛池策略;同时结合实际应用案例进行分析和总结;我们可以为不同类型的网站提供更具针对性的优化建议和实践指导,未来随着技术的不断发展和进步;相信百度蜘蛛池将会变得更加智能、高效且易于使用;为SEO从业者带来更多便利和价值。

浏览量:
@新花城 版权所有 转载需经授权